Fortinet FortiWeb 600E.
Hardware-accelerated SSL for mid-size enterprise apps.
The FortiWeb 600E is the first model in the lineup with dedicated hardware SSL/TLS acceleration, built-in
bypass ports for fail-open resiliency, and dual power supplies for production data-path deployments. It's
aimed at mid-size enterprises running SSL-heavy workloads that need inline protection without a throughput
bottleneck.
4x GE RJ45 ports (2 bypass-capable). 4x GE SFP ports. 2x USB ports.
Storage & Power
480 GB SSD onboard. Dual AC power supplies for redundancy. 1U rack-mount, ~22 lbs.
Resiliency
Hardware bypass ports keep traffic flowing if the appliance loses
power. Active/Passive and Active/Active HA clustering. Up to 32 administrative domains.

The Fortinet FortiWeb 600E is a Web Application Firewall (WAF) that inspects
HTTP/HTTPS traffic to protect web applications and APIs from OWASP Top 10 attacks, bot abuse, and
zero-day exploits. It is typically deployed by mid-size enterprises running SSL-heavy,
production-critical web applications.
The FortiWeb 600E is rated for up to 750 Mbps of protected WAF throughput. Actual
throughput depends on which inspection features (SSL offload, deep content inspection, bot mitigation)
are enabled.
The 600E reached End of Sale around 2024-12-29 and is no longer available for new
purchase; Fortinet support runs through roughly 2029-12-29. We recommend the current-generation
FortiWeb 600F for new deployments.
